The happiest rush hour of the year is just two days away! Bike Everywhere Day 2018 (formerly known as “Bike to Work Day”) is Friday, and the city will be flush with snacks and swag and group rides and smiling faces.
There is usually an extra surge of people in the city’s bike routes, and there is no better day for someone to give biking to work (or school or the park or wherever) to give it a try. Biking gets safer and more comfortable as more people do it.
One great way to participate: Join a group ride to City Hall. Rides are starting all over the city. Details from the event listing:
- Beacon Hill, Beacon Hill Light Rail Station, Beacon Ave S and Lander St (meets at 7:30 am; departs 7:45 am)
- Columbia City, Bikeworks, 3709 S Ferdinand St (meets at 7:00 am, departs 7:15 am)
- Fremont, Florentia & 4th Ave. N. (meets at 7:15 am, departs 7:30 am)
- Ravenna, Third Place Books, 6504 20th Ave NE, (meets at 7:15 am; departs 7:30 am)
- West Seattle, Beneath the West Seattle Bridge (meets at 7:15 am, departs 7:30 am)
